Central African Republic's inflation rate stands at 1% as of 2025-12-31, down from 1.48% in 2024. Historical data runs from 1981 to 2025 (45 observations).
In 2025, Central African Republic's inflation rate was 1%, down from 1.48% in 2024.
In 2024, Central African Republic's inflation rate was 1.48%, down from 2.98% in 2023.
In 2023, Central African Republic's inflation rate was 2.98%, down from 5.58% in 2022.
In 2022, Central African Republic's inflation rate was 5.58%, up from 4.26% in 2021.
In 2021, Central African Republic's inflation rate was 4.26%, up from 1.71% in 2020.
| Year | Value | Change |
|---|---|---|
| 2025 | 1% | -0.4754% |
| 2024 | 1.48% | -1.5% |
| 2023 | 2.98% | -2.6% |
| 2022 | 5.58% | +1.32% |
| 2021 | 4.26% | +2.55% |
| 2020 | 1.71% | -0.9752% |
| 2019 | 2.69% | +1.07% |
| 2018 | 1.61% | -2.57% |
| 2017 | 4.18% | -0.7647% |
| 2016 | 4.95% | +3.54% |
| 2015 | 1.4% | -13.5% |
| 2014 | 14.9% | +7.91% |
| 2013 | 6.99% | +1.51% |
| 2012 | 5.48% | +4.28% |
| 2011 | 1.19% | -0.2965% |
| 2010 | 1.49% | -2.03% |
| 2009 | 3.52% | -5.74% |
| 2008 | 9.26% | +8.3% |
| 2007 | 0.9599% | -5.74% |
| 2006 | 6.7% | +3.81% |
| 2005 | 2.88% | +4.95% |
| 2004 | -2.07% | -6.2% |
| 2003 | 4.13% | +1.8% |
| 2002 | 2.33% | -1.5% |
| 2001 | 3.83% | +0.6315% |
| 2000 | 3.2% | +4.62% |
| 1999 | -1.41% | +0.471% |
| 1998 | -1.89% | -3.5% |
| 1997 | 1.61% | -2.11% |
| 1996 | 3.72% | -15.46% |
| 1995 | 19.19% | -5.38% |
| 1994 | 24.57% | +27.49% |
| 1993 | -2.92% | -1.88% |
| 1992 | -1.03% | +1.73% |
| 1991 | -2.76% | -2.75% |
| 1990 | -0.0123% | -0.7014% |
| 1989 | 0.6891% | +4.65% |
| 1988 | -3.96% | +3.02% |
| 1987 | -6.99% | -9.23% |
| 1986 | 2.25% | -8.18% |
| 1985 | 10.42% | +7.88% |
| 1984 | 2.54% | -12.07% |
| 1983 | 14.61% | +1.32% |
| 1982 | 13.3% | +13.33% |
| 1981 | -0.0333% | — |
